How MMDM works?
(FAQs/MMDMs)
MMDM
consists of a thin (500 to 700nm thick) membrane made of silicon nitride. The membrane is coated by a thin layer of aluminum or gold to produce a highly reflective surface. The membrane is fixed to ...

What is "biased operation"?
(FAQs/MMDMs)
The
MMDM
membrane can be deflected only in the direction of the electrode structure because the electrostatic force can be only attractive. This means the deflected membrane can produce only concave optical ...
